**Management Meeting Minutes — Loyalty Overhaul**

Attendees reviewed the proposed restructuring of the Corvane Club programme. It was agreed that the existing points ledger would be migrated in two phases, beginning with the Halloway region. Heads of department raised concerns about redemption liability during the transition; Finance will model exposure before the next session. Marketing committed to a revised member communication plan. All discussion remains restricted pending sign-off. The confidential business note is recorded below.

internal memo for kawip-hadug: Headcount on the Wenwyn team goes from 7 to 140 by the end of January. Gross margin on Wenwyn came in at 20 percent against a plan of 15 percent.

Q3 Planning Note — Department Heads

Following the annual count at the Veldmoor warehouse, we will record an inventory write-down on slow-moving Cartwheel series components. The adjustment affects Q3 margins but not cash. Department heads should update their forecasts accordingly before the planning session on Friday. Context for the decision follows below.

board note of fahif-yahog: Gross margin on Wenath came in at 10 percent against a plan of 5 percent. Only 3 of the 100 pilot accounts renewed Wenath, so a churn review is set for July 15.

## Authentication

The Lanternkeep rate-parity checker compares published room rates across partner channels on an hourly schedule. Every scrape job authenticates against the parity API before fetching channel snapshots, and unauthenticated calls are rejected with a 403. For this week's sync demo, the shared staging environment is already provisioned. Run the demo using the bearer token below.

session JWT of yawep-yawep = eyJhbGciOiJIUzI1NiIsInR5cCI6IkpXVCJ9.eyJzdWIiOiI3pWF3_In0.aXYsHiog

## Escalation: Payroll Export Format Change

If the Ledgerline nightly export starts failing schema validation, odds are Wageworks pushed another format tweak without telling us. First, check the parser version pin and the change log in the `export-formats` repo. If the new format isn't documented there, don't patch blind — roll back to the last good mapping and escalate. The Payroll Integrations team handles vendor coordination; email them with the failing batch attached.

escalation mailbox, bafog-fafog: ulador@paliqlabs.internal